Plugin Description

I’d love a plugin that splits messages into smaller chunks when they exceed Discord’s character limit. It should automatically handle this so we don’t have to manually break up long texts. The split messages should be sent in sequence, and maybe a quick alert to let us know it’s happening would be great.
